6.1 IntroductIon
Games and sports in some form or the other have been a part of human life either for survival or for pleasure. Gradually human beings started organising events including games and sports as community events. Consequently, the need was felt to acquire specific skills and advancement in many sports. Each sport has its specific skills which need to be developed for playing correctly. In this chapter we are going to discuss how some individual sports have evolved and how to develop proficiency in playing these sports. Rules and regulations of these sports are revised from time to time by there federations.
 
6.2 BadmInton
Badminton is a game which is played by men, women (Singles/Doubles) and both men and women ( Mixed Doubles) together. It can be played by persons of all ages. The first set of rules were formulated in Pune, in India in 1901. These rules were gradually adopted by other nations. Due to this reason, it is believed that badminton originated in India. However, the game became an international sport after the first All England Championship. In 1934, the International Badminton Federation (IBF) was formed and the rules of the game were standardised. World Badminton Federation (WBF) regulates the game. Badminton Association of India came into existence in 1934 and various State Badminton Associations are affiliated to it.
 
6.2.1 Types of Events
• Singles (boys, girls),
• Doubles (boys, girls),
• Mixed Doubles (Combination of a boy and a girl)
 
6.2.2 Facilities and Equipment
• For playing badminton, a racket, net and shuttle cock are required.
• Court measurements: The length and width of the doubles court shall be of 13.40m × 6.10m. The height of the net is 1.55m at the sides and 1.52m at the centre.
